【问题标题】:Download dependencies in gradle, Android Studio在 gradle、Android Studio 中下载依赖项
【发布时间】:2018-04-19 08:44:40
【问题描述】:

我需要下载一个Android项目中所有模块的依赖源jar文件列表。

我厌倦了下面的代码,但它给出了错误,因为这仅适用于 java 项目,不适用于 android 项目。

 task copyToLib(type: Copy) {
     into "libDownload"
     from configurations.compile
 }
 build.dependsOn(copyToLib)

configurations.compile 出错,我的项目有构建变体。

【问题讨论】:

标签: android android-studio gradle dependencies


【解决方案1】:

尝试用configurations.runtime替换configurations.compile

task copyToLib(type: Copy) { into "$buildDir/output/libs" from configurations.runtime } build.dependsOn(copyToLib)

【讨论】:

  • 我收到“无法获取配置容器的未知属性 'runtime'。”
  • 对于支持implementationapi 配置的任何Gradle 版本,您应该使用configurations.runtimeClasspath 代替configurations.runtime
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 2015-01-25
  • 2023-03-15
  • 1970-01-01
  • 1970-01-01
  • 2021-02-10
  • 2014-03-15
  • 2014-04-03
相关资源
最近更新 更多